While medication is the primary component of treatment for ADHD but it's not the only option. The condition can be treated using behavior therapy, dietary modifications and supplements.

Stimulants improve concentration and focus through the increase of brain chemicals, norepinephrine as well as dopamine. Non-stimulants can be used when stimulants trigger unpleasant adverse long-term effects of untreated adhd in adults.

1. Eating clean

Many people believe that diet can play a major part in ADHD symptoms. Research has shown certain foods can cause ADHD children hyperactive, whereas others can reduce or improve symptoms. Many parents treat their children's ADHD by introducing food.

Some ADHD experts advise not to consume a large number of foods and chemicals that are commonly found in processed foods. They suggest a diet that is rich in whole foods, and preferably unprocessed, or less processed, like fruits, vegetables and whole grains. This type of diet helps to maintain a steady mood and balance blood sugar levels.

2. Avoiding allergies and sensitivities

Many children and adults suffering from ADHD suffer from food allergies and sensitivities. Eliminating these food items may aid in reducing ADHD symptoms. Food dyes, MSG, a preservative that is found in processed foods and artificial sweeteners are among the foods to avoid. Nitrites in canned foods and lunchmeat are also harmful because they affect the hormones that regulate the central nervous system. This increases blood pressure, heart rate, and breathing problems.

Food allergy testing is important for finding what foods trigger ADHD symptoms. Once the ingredient or food that is responsible for the symptoms has been identified, it can be eliminated from the diet. This will allow your body to heal and resume normal functioning. A single-food elimination diet is often used, in which a food or food additive is eliminated from the diet for a specified period of time. The food is then reintroduced and the symptoms are observed. This method of identifying food allergies can be difficult and should always be performed under the supervision of a doctor or registered dietitian.

In addition to eliminating foods that are known to cause problems, children with ADHD should try to take regular meals even if they don't feel hungry. This will help stabilize their blood sugar levels and lessen the effects of stimulants on the brain.

3. Get Better Sleep

A good night's sleep is one of the most important natural remedies for adults and children suffering from ADHD. Insufficient sleep can exacerbate attention and mood problems which is why it is crucial to get the right amount of sleep each night.

Consult your physician If you're having difficulty getting to sleep or staying asleep. There are a variety of reasons why you might be experiencing difficulties with sleep, such as sleep disturbances or medications that interfere with the body's ability to relax.

Additionally, sleep issues can occur when you take stimulant medications for ADHD. Certain studies suggest that stimulant drugs like Ritalin and Adderall may affect your sleep. You can combat these sleep issues by taking your medicine at the same time each day, avoiding caffeine and daytime napping, and requesting four-hour doses instead of extended-release meds.

Lack of sleep can make it difficult to concentrate and focus and focus, so if you're struggling trying to get the recommended 10-11 hours each night for teens and children. It can also help establish a routine for bedtime and keep your room dark and silent.

4. Meditation

Just like a muscle, the brain needs exercise to maintain its health. Meditation can help build the focus area of the brain. It teaches people to observe their thoughts and feelings and helps them return their wandering thoughts to the present moment.

Meditation can also help balance brain neurotransmitter levels. This can alleviate ADHD symptoms. Meditation has been found to boost brain dopamine levels which is crucial since low levels of dopamine can be related How to treat depression and adhd ADHD.

The key to making meditation work is consistency. Just like with exercising, it's crucial to establish a plan and adhere to it. Finding a meditation partner who can diagnose and treat adhd will hold your accountable is also helpful. This can help you maintain a daily routine. You can also try different meditation methods until you find the one that works best for you.

5. Exercise

Many people suffering from ADHD struggle to keep their bodies and minds active. This is a large part of what causes their hyperactive and impulsive behavior. By increasing your physical activity, you will assist your brain to focus. You may be able to see that it helps reduce your symptoms and increases your ability to control your mood and behavior.

Exercise has also been found to increase dopamine levels in your brain, a chemical which enhances attention and focus. It also helps reduce depression and anxiety, which are often linked to ADHD. Exercise is more effective in combating depression, anxiety and ADHD in adults than medication.

Try to do at minimum 30 minutes of moderate intensity exercise each day, and four or five days a week. You can try activities like dancing, running, biking, or swimming. It is crucial to pick an activity you love and are able to keep up with. Selecting an activity that you enjoy can help you get motivated to complete it, particularly when you exercise in a social group.
